How much does it cost to rent a home in Eureka?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Eureka 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,122 | $595 | $2,300 |
Eureka 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,345 | $836 | $2,500 |
Eureka 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,225 | $850 | $1,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Eureka
What type of rentals are currently available in Eureka?
There are currently 43 Apartments for Rent in Eureka, IL with pricing that ranges from $575 to $2,675. There are also 40 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Eureka ranging from $595 to $2,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Eureka?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Eureka ranges from $595 to $2,500 with an average monthly rent of $1,026.
